    Yes, I've shot katipo very unsuccessfully out of my ar. I hope to develop a hand load that can match the American Eagle out of my cmmg, its so accurate it just pinholes it. Have found seating depth to be the biggest definer of accuracy in my case, longer rounds seem to shoot better.

    Yeah I've got the rce with 1:7 twist. I've read that the american eagles are just vmax but still can't get vmax hand loads as accurate
    Cheap hornady and copper coated projectiles only good enough for 3 gun but can get Berger and targex projectiles to group nicely.
    Was worried at the start and if I hadn't found the ae223 rounds I'd have sent the gun back
